Personal Care Help
While steering daily life can present difficulties for people with specials needs, individual treatment aid offers essential support tailored to their unique requirements. This sort of home care service encompasses a range of activities made to advertise freedom and improve lifestyle. Personal treatment aides help with everyday jobs such as bathing, dressing, grooming, and toileting, ensuring individuals keep personal hygiene and convenience. They may likewise assist with dish preparation, medicine administration, and flexibility assistance. By giving individualized treatment, these specialists encourage individuals to involve even more fully in their everyday routines and social tasks. In general, personal treatment assistance plays a substantial role in fostering self-respect and freedom for those with impairments, permitting them to flourish in their home setting.

Reprieve Treatment Options
Reprieve treatment functions as a crucial source for family members and caretakers of individuals with disabilities, supplying momentary alleviation from the demands of everyday caregiving. This sort of service can take different kinds, including in-home respite care, where qualified experts see the home to assist with care jobs. Alternatively, families may opt for facility-based respite care, where people receive treatment in a specific environment, allowing caregivers to relax. In addition, some companies use emergency situation break services for unexpected conditions. These alternatives not only help relieve caretaker stress and anxiety however also promote the health of individuals with disabilities by using them new experiences and social communication. Overall, reprieve care plays a vital role in supporting both caretakers and those they take care of.

Eligibility Standards Explained
To receive NDIS home care services, individuals must fulfill certain eligibility standards that assess their demands and circumstances. Applicants need to be matured in between 7 and 65 years and have a permanent and considerable special needs that influences their ability to execute day-to-day activities. Additionally, they must be an Australian person, a permanent citizen, or hold a Protected Unique Category Visa. The NDIS calls for proof of the special needs, usually with medical evaluations or reports. In addition, people ought to demonstrate that they require support to join social and economic life. These standards guarantee that solutions are directed in the direction of those who genuinely need assistance, promoting independence and boosted lifestyle for people with disabilities.
Application Process Actions
Navigating the application procedure for NDIS home treatment solutions includes numerous clear steps that people need to follow to ensure an effective outcome. Initially, prospective applicants ought to identify their eligibility based on the criteria established by the NDIS. Next, they need to gather appropriate documentation, including clinical records and personal recognition. Following this, individuals can finish the Accessibility Demand Form, which is essential for launching the application. When submitted, the NDIS will certainly evaluate the application and might ask for added information or clarification. After authorization, individuals can create a tailored strategy detailing their certain requirements and assistance preferences. They can choose authorized service providers to provide the required home care services, making sure that they obtain appropriate aid tailored to their requirements.
